Middleboro Quote Checklist

Use these checks when comparing HVAC contractors serving Middleboro. They are designed to make each estimate more specific, easier to verify, and less dependent on generic averages.

  • Confirm whether ductwork, thermostat wiring, drain lines, and permits are included.
  • Verify refrigerant type and parts availability on older systems.
  • Compare seer2, hspf2, warranty length, and labor coverage instead of equipment price alone.
  • Request maintenance plan terms separately from the repair or replacement quote.
  • Ask for the estimate, warranty, exclusions, and scheduling assumptions in writing.

For HVAC, that means the HVAC service quote should separate diagnosis, equipment sizing, duct or airflow assumptions, permit work, warranty terms, and seasonal scheduling risk.

Estimate itemWhy it mattersQuestion to ask
Permit and code workElectrical, venting, drain, platform, and disconnect updates may be outside the base equipment price.Which code or permit items are included in writing?
Duct and airflowDuct restrictions, returns, filters, and static pressure can affect comfort after the repair.Did the quote include airflow checks and ductwork assumptions?
Load calculationReplacement equipment should be sized to the home, not only matched to the old unit.Will the estimate include a Manual J or documented load calculation?
Refrigerant and partsOlder systems can be more expensive to repair when refrigerant or boards are limited.What refrigerant type and key parts are required?

When to Call Now vs. Plan Ahead in Middleboro

Call sooner when you see

  • Carbon monoxide alarm, combustion concern, or blocked venting.
  • Refrigerant-line icing, major water overflow, or a system that repeatedly shuts down.
  • No heat during freezing conditions or no cooling during dangerous heat.

Plan ahead for

  • Filter, drain, and condensate checks before extended travel.
  • Replacement planning for older systems before peak-season demand.
  • Maintenance before the first heavy heating or cooling period.

Picking the Best HVAC Service in Middleboro

When selecting an HVAC contractor in Middleboro, consider these important factors:

  • Licensing: Verify the contractor holds proper Massachusetts HVAC licensing
  • Insurance: Confirm liability coverage and workers' compensation
  • Experience: Ask about experience with your specific HVAC system type
  • Reviews: Check online reviews and request local references
  • Estimates: Get written estimates before major work begins
  • Warranties: Understand warranty coverage on parts and labor

Middleboro Seasonal Heating and Cooling

Proper seasonal maintenance keeps your Middleboro HVAC running efficiently:

  • Fall: Schedule furnace inspection before heating season
  • Winter: Change filters monthly during heavy heating use
  • Spring: Have AC serviced before summer arrives
  • Summer: Keep outdoor units clear of debris

Energy-Efficient Heating and Cooling in Middleboro

Reduce energy costs in your Middleboro home with these HVAC efficiency tips:

  • Keep filters clean—replace every 1-3 months
  • Seal air leaks around windows and doors
  • Use a programmable or smart thermostat
  • Schedule annual professional maintenance
  • Ensure adequate attic insulation
  • Keep vents unobstructed by furniture

What causes high energy bills with HVAC in Middleboro?

High Middleboro energy bills can result from poor insulation, aging equipment, dirty filters, duct leaks, or incorrect thermostat settings. An energy audit can identify issues.

How often should I change my HVAC filter in Middleboro?

In Middleboro, change standard filters every 1-3 months. Check monthly during heavy use seasons. Homes with pets or allergies may need more frequent changes.
